Recent spikes in online searches and media coverage have brought renewed attention to the concepts of eco-localism and tariff terrorism. While both involve trade-related strategies, experts confirm they are fundamentally different in purpose and approach, affecting international policy debates and economic stability.

Eco-localism is a movement advocating for promoting local economies, sustainable resource use, and community resilience, often driven by environmental concerns. It emphasizes reducing dependence on global supply chains to lower carbon footprints and strengthen local industries. Conversely, tariff terrorism refers to the strategic use of tariffs, trade barriers, or economic sanctions as coercive tools aimed at pressuring other nations, often without regard for environmental or social impacts. This tactic can escalate trade conflicts, disrupt global markets, and provoke retaliatory measures.

According to trade policy analysts, the key difference lies in intent and methodology: eco-localism seeks to foster sustainability and community well-being, while tariff terrorism aims to leverage economic pressure for political or strategic gains. While both can involve trade restrictions, their goals and consequences diverge sharply.

Recent discussions, especially among policymakers and economists, highlight that conflating these concepts can lead to misunderstandings about trade strategies and environmental initiatives. Experts warn that policies rooted in eco-localism can complement sustainable development goals, whereas tariff terrorism risks escalating conflicts and destabilizing global markets.

Implications for Trade Policy and Environmental Goals

This distinction matters because it influences how governments and organizations craft policies in trade and sustainability. Recognizing eco-localism as a constructive approach can foster cooperative efforts to build resilient local economies and reduce environmental impact. Conversely, understanding tariff terrorism as a disruptive tactic underscores the risks of escalating trade conflicts, which can harm global economic stability and hinder environmental initiatives.

For consumers and businesses, these differences affect supply chains, prices, and environmental outcomes. Policymakers who differentiate between the two can better design strategies that promote sustainability without provoking unnecessary trade disputes. The ongoing debate also impacts international relations, as countries navigate balancing economic security with environmental commitments.

Growing Interest Amid Global Trade and Environmental Tensions

Interest in eco-localism and tariff tactics has surged over the past year, driven by increasing concerns over climate change, supply chain disruptions, and geopolitical conflicts. The trend is reflected in rising online search volumes and media coverage, although the exact trigger remains unconfirmed. Analysts suggest that recent trade disputes involving major economies and debates over sustainable development have contributed to this heightened attention.

Historically, eco-localism has been promoted as a grassroots and policy-driven movement aimed at fostering local resilience, especially in the face of global supply chain vulnerabilities. Tariff terrorism, by contrast, has emerged as a more aggressive trade strategy, often associated with protectionism and economic coercion. The lines between these approaches are sometimes blurred in public discourse, leading to confusion about their respective roles and impacts.

Experts note that understanding the clear differences is crucial for policymakers seeking to balance economic security with environmental sustainability, especially as global tensions over trade and climate policy intensify.
